The history of women’s activism in Singapore : Persatuan Pemudi Islam Singapura (PPIS) as a case study

This paper examines the Persatuan Pemudi Islam Singapura (PPIS), a Malay/Muslim women’s organisation marginally studied in the dominant discourse of the history of women’s activism in Singapore.
